Has everyone who has found that Safari 5 broke CAC access to some web sites (for example infosec.navy.mil) but not others filed bug reports?
It's been nine months since I filed a detailed bug report based on a multiple clean installs with different versions of OS X and Safari and what worked since OS X 10.3.x is still broken in Safari 5. Meanwhile Safari 4.0.5 and Chrome using the same system libraries/frameworks work just fine on the web sites that Safari 5 glitches on.
One point made in a recent discussion with experienced people is that without bug reports from the affected people the bug will not be fixed as the priority depends on the number of customers affected by the bug which is reflected in bean counter terms by the number of bug reports.
Given that there is a work around, i.e. Google Chrome, I'm not sure I can get any of my coworkers interested enough to create Developer accounts and file a bug report.
